Aliyah Taylor has arrived!
4/28/2007
9:51am
7lbs 5oz, 19.5 inches

Well Thursday night I started having contractions and I layed in bed watching TV until they were 6-7 minutes apart for an hour then I woke up my husband at about 2am and it took a minute for it to sink in that I wasn't joking and it was time to go. We packed up our bags and checked in to the hospital. When they checked I was dialated to 4/5 and she said I'd be staying. Probably about 2 hours later I got an epidural and was in happy land. I felt almost nothing. the only thing I did feel was some pressure but sometimes not even the pressure of the contractions. My doc came in around 6am and checked me and I was dialated to a 10 so she broke my water and there was meniconium in there, she said we'd just wait until I started feeling the pressure to push. I never felt the pressure, but while we were waiting I suddenly had to throw up and I threw up and we grabbed a nurse and as soon as the nurse came in she immediatly ran back out and pretty soon my room had like 10 people in there rushing around putting oxygen on me and spreading my legs open and hooking up internal monitors and doing all sorts of stuff. Turns out when I threw up I pushed her down really fast and the cord wrapped around her neck and made her heart rate drop really low. After a few minutes of them doing whatever they did her heart rate went back up and then the Dr. said we'd start trying to push. Her heart rate went down everytime but picked right back up as soon as I stopped so she had the real Doc on standby for a c-section (she's a midwife, can't do that) and she had pitocin and a vacuum on standby as well, but didn't have to use any of them. So I pushed for probably about an hour and out she came.

My total labor including the hour at home was only 8 hours. And after the epidural I felt no pain at all, we were cracking jokes and laughing in between pushes. I got really, really lucky, even my small drama of her heart rate dropping only lasted about 10 minutes and then everything went back to being a piece of cake. I'm even doing great pain wise. My tear was a 2nd degree tear and for the last two days I've heard nothing but nurses exclaiming how horrible I look down below but it's mildley sore.

Breastfeeding has been more challenging. I couldn't get her to latch on myself and I got zero sleep at the hospital, but before I was allowed to leave the hospital I had to get her to latch on by myself or else they wanted me there another night. I finally am able to but she still pinches a little so sometimes I have to use a breast shield to get her on ok.
